From the moment she set eyes on it Molly Pargeter (susan Fleetwood) knew that she had to take the villa La Felicita in Tuscany, Italy for her familys summer holiday. Since childhood she had cherished a passion for Italy and art and the Tuscan escape offered the promise of viewing priceless art and relaxed sunny days, far from her stable, dull life in west London
Undeterred by the bossy and patronising tone of her would-be landlord, Molly takes her unwilling family and all-too-willing father, aged rou and columnist Haverford Downs (John Gielgud), to the hills of Italy. When the water supply mysteriously fails, and a neighbour suddenly dies she finds herself increasingly obsessed with unravelling the secrets of the villas enigmatic land-lord and becomes dangerously involved with the curious concerns of the local expatriate community
John Mortimer triumphs again with an elegant story of atmosphere, comedy and mystery, full of brilliantly captured performances by a host of British character actors including an Emmy award-winning performance by John Gielgud.
